Application Requirements:
Timing systems must comply with conditions outlined in 102.24 USA Swimming Rules & Regulations.
Officiating:
A) The number of Association officials must meet the minimum requirements (a referee, starter and two stroke and turn officials) as provided in Article 102.10 – USA Swimming Rules & Regulations. If the association stroke and turn officials are also certified by USA-S and are stationed at each end of the pool, no additional observers are necessary. Officials may note compliance with USA Swimming Technical Rules only for those swimmers requesting observation, or the entire meet may be observed.
B) Or, a minimum of two USA Swimming certified officials shall be assigned, one at each end of the pool, to verify compliance with USA Swimming Rules for those swims requested to be observed.
C) Where the technical rules as listed in Article 101 are the same as the host organization, the judgment of the organization officials shall be sufficient.
D) The designated USA Swimming certified official must verify compliance with applicable rules and procedures, and shall forward any proof of times requests and final results for observed meets to the times chair.
Proof of Times Requests:
A) If an athlete’s USA-S ID # or full legal name and birth date is included in the electronic meet results, no individual request for data entry into the SWIMS system should be necessary. The LSC NTV official or SWIMS data officer shall enter times for any such athlete into SWIMS.
b) If the above data is not included in the electronic results, individual requests for times may be submitted using Form C (Click here).
